Easy Slow Cooker Roast Beef (Serves: 6 - generous portions)

Ingredients

- 1 4-5 pound beef roast (I prefer chuck or rib roast for this recipe)

- 1 Tbsp olive oil

- 1/4 cup Montreal Steak Spice (Club House brand is what I use)

- 1 cup low sodium beef broth

Directions

1. Remove roast from packaging and place on cutting board. Rub roast all over with olive oil. Begin to sprinkle spice rub all over the roast, including the top, bottom and sides. Use your hands to press the rub onto the beef.

2. Use tongs to transfer roast to large frying pan. Over medium high heat, sear each side of the roast. This helps to lock in moisture, flavour and adds a nice crust to the roast. Each side is done when it's a golden brown colour (about 2-3 minutes per side).

3. Pour beef broth into slow cooker and place seared and seasoned roast in as well. Cook on low for up to 8 hours (for a well done roast) or up to 3 hours on high (for medium well). Play around with the cooking time depending on the doneness that you prefer!

Ways to Enjoy The Roast

1. Roast Beef Dinner

- Follow directions for roast beef above. To the slow cooker, add in 1 large chopped onion, 4 large peeled & chopped potatoes & 4 large peeled & chopped carrots. Cook time is the same as above.

- Remove roast and vegetables. Strain cooking liquid to remove and lumps and bumps. Place liquid in a small sauce pan and bring to a simmer. Reserve 1/4 cup of the liquid and whisk in 2 tablespoons of flour to make a slurry. Add slurry to simmering liquid and bring to boil until thick. Enjoy!

2. Philly Cheese Steak Sandwich

- Follow directions for roast beef above.

- In a large frying pan, saute 2 large sliced bell peppers, 1 large sliced onion in 1 tablespoon olive oil with 2 cloves minced garlic. Season with salt and pepper, cooking until tender.

- On a large bun or on 2 pieces of sandwich bread, place 2 pieces of cheese (monterey jack works best here!), desired amount of roast beef & vegetables. Use a panini press to grill sandwich or place open faced on a cookie sheet under LOW broil in your oven until cheese is melty and delicious. Enjoy!
